Bears Return to Krkonoše Mountains After Three Centuries
After three centuries, bears are symbolically returning to the Krkonoše (Giant Mountains) in the Czech Republic. The project involves a carefully prepared environment, blending nature conservation with a unique experience, rather than releasing them into the wild.
